Abstract: A radical-initiated emulsion polymerisation method for the preparation of an aqueous polymer dispersion, containing at least one compound with an ethylenic unsaturated group emulsified in an aqueous medium using a dispersant, is carried out using a radical polymerisation initiator in the presence of a stabil N-oxyl radical. The initiator is a (hydro)peroxide and/or azo compound which has a molar solubility in water at 25 deg C and a bar which is greater than or equal to the corresponding molar solubility of tert-butyl hydroperoxide in water, and which has a degradation temperature less than 100 deg C in the polymerisation medium. The polymerisation step is carried out at a temperature greater than 100 deg C at a pressure greater than the vapour pressure of the polymer mixture present in the polymerisation vessel. Also claimed are aqueous polymer dispersions prepared by this method.

Abstract: A thermoplastic moulding composition (I) contains (A) 10-98 wt.% polyamide (B) 1-20 wt.% red phosphorous (C) 0.1-15 wt.% delaminated layer silicate (phyllosilicate) (D) 0-70 wt.% additional additives and processing aids. An article (II) prepared from the composition (I) is also claimed. Preferably the composition (I) contains 5-40 wt.% fibrous reinforcement as component (D). The polyamide (A) contains at least 5 wt.% units resulting from lactam monomers. (A) comprises 5-95 wt.% (A1) polyamide 6 and 5-95 wt.% (A2) a different polyamide. (A) is polyamide 6, polyamide 12, polyamide 6/66, polyamide 6/6T, polyamide 6/6I, polyamide 66, polyamide 610 and /or polyamide 46. The layer silicate (C) is montmorillonite, smectite, illite, sepiolite, polygorskite, muscovite, allevardite, amesite, hectorite, talc, fluorhectorite, beidellite, nontronite, stevensite, bentonite, mica, vermiculite, fluorvermiculite, halloysite and/or fluorine containing synthetic talc. The moulded article (II) has a layer structure equivalent to 1--2-1-n-Z; 1 = the thermoplastic matrix; and 2 = the delaminated layer silicate, having preferably a 40 deg A gap between layers.

Abstract: Block copolymers (BC) prepared by reacting the following monomers at 100-160 deg C in the presence of radical initiators and N-oxyl radicals are new :(A) monomers chosen from (alpha-methyl)styrene, (meth)acrylonitrile, methyl methacrylate or maleic acid, forming blocks with a glass transition temperature (Tg) greater than 0 deg C ; and (B) monomers chosen from n-butyl acrylate, methyl acrylate or 2-ethylhexyl acrylate, forming blocks with a Tg less 0 deg C. Also claimed are (i) the preparation of (BC), (ii) transparent or translucent films or moulded articles comprising (BC), and (iii) the use of (BC) for the preparation of these films or articles.
